About the Role
We are seeking a highly organized, proactive, and detail-oriented Executive Assistant to the Director of Legal Operations to support fast-paced personal injury law firm operations and strategic initiatives.
This role plays a critical part in ensuring the Director of Legal Operations remains focused on high-impact priorities by managing day-to-day operational, administrative, and coordination responsibilities across multiple legal and operational workflows.
The ideal candidate thrives in dynamic environments, is highly tech-savvy, comfortable handling confidential information, and capable of managing shifting priorities with professionalism and efficiency.
This is an excellent opportunity for someone interested in legal operations, operational excellence, project coordination, and executive support within the legal services industry.
Key Responsibilities
Operational & Administrative Support
Manage the Director’s calendar, including:Internal meetings
Attorney check-ins
Vendor calls
Performance reviews
Project deadlines

Coordinate daily workflows and ensure meeting preparedness with agendas, documents, and follow-up items
Organize SOP updates, training materials, and operational projects
Maintain organized digital files, shared drives, and project management systems
Prepare meeting summaries, reports, and action item trackers
Legal Operations Support
Assist with monitoring:Case pipeline metrics
Intake performance
Departmental KPIs

Support audits of case files, intake calls, and workflow compliance processes
Coordinate communication between consulting clients and legal teams
Assist with vendor coordination involving:Medical providers
Investigators
Experts
External partners

Communication & Coordination
Draft professional emails, internal communications, announcements, and memos
Facilitate communication between attorneys, paralegals, intake specialists, administrative staff, and leadership teams
Maintain strict confidentiality and professionalism in all communications and documentation
Project & Process Management
Track operational initiatives including:SOP rollouts
Training implementation
Technology initiatives
Performance improvement plans

Assist in preparing training materials, checklists, and documentation
Coordinate meetings, workshops, and training sessions
Monitor deadlines and ensure operational tasks are completed on time
Technology & Reporting
Maintain spreadsheets, dashboards, and operational performance trackers
Support administrative and reporting workflows using cloud-based tools and project management platforms
Assist in improving organizational efficiency through technology and process organization
